  • What to Do During a Dental Emergency?

    Whenever you notice an issue with your mouth or teeth to the point of a dental emergency, it’s easy to start panicking in regard to the next steps you must take next. Whenever you enter a dental emergency, there are a few steps that you can take to help fix the issue, such as don't panic and act promptly.

    • Stay calm: It’s easy to worry at any time when these emergencies happen. Please attempt to stay calm and think through the situation. Whether you have a cracked tooth or some aching and swelling in the mouth, you need to work through the situation and keep cool.
    • Act efficiently: Whenever you experience a dental emergency, you need to act in the most efficient way. Request a member of your family contact the Leesburg, FL emergency dentist or help to take you into the office. You might want to bring an ice pack or some pain relievers in order to help deal with the swelling and pain. A clean gauze on the part of the mouth that’s bleeding will help slow it down.
    • Find and preserve the oral structures: If a tooth is broken or gets dislodged, it’s recommended you find any of the pieces that you are able to. After they have been collected, you can place them inside of a sealed container. You can show the tooth segments to Leesburg dental professional when you are at the office.

    • How to Prevent Dental Emergencies

      You could take several different steps you can take to help ward off dental emergencies and keep your mouth as healthy as is possible. Some of the steps you can take to fend off these dental emergencies include: Watch what you eat: Eat healthy and wholesome food in order to help with cavities. Numerous dental emergencies stem from something small, like a minor cavity, which can become a big toothache that demands a lot of treatment. Cut down on any liquids and food that are sugary and eat as healthy as possible. 2) Protect yourself from dental trauma: Whether you engage in a sport that can result in mouth injury or you grind your teeth at night, you need to use a mouthguard to keep yourself safe. 3) Practice good oral hygiene: Make sure you are brushing your teeth twice a day, floss at least one time a day, and rinse your mouth with mouthwash in order to keep your mouth healthy and avert oral health issues.
